WebSep 15, 2024 · The United States remains Nicaragua’s top economic partner, buying 50 percent of Nicaraguan exports and supplying 27 percent of its imports, and sending 67 percent of its remittances. Total (two-way) goods trade between the two countries was $6.8 billion in 2024. The United States was also the origin of 18 percent of its tourists, … WebApr 29, 2016 · Registering a business is not easy in Nicaragua, which has been ranked 125 out of 189 worldwide for Ease of Doing Business. Starting a (formal) business in Nicaragua typically takes 6 procedures, 13 days of work, and costs 72.2% of income per capita (or 17 minimum wages).
